A Hidden Gem in Negros Occidental
Mag-Aso Falls is located in Barangay Oringao, about 20 kilometers from the city center of Kabankalan. The name “Mag-Aso” is derived from the Hiligaynon word for smoke, referring to the mist created by the cascading waters as they crash into the pool below. This mist, combined with the verdant greenery and towering rock formations, creates a magical and tranquil atmosphere that captivates every visitor.
The Enchanting Falls
As you approach Mag-Aso Falls, the sound of rushing water grows louder, heightening your anticipation. Standing at approximately eight meters high, the falls cascade into a pool that is perfect for swimming. The refreshingly cool water provides a welcome respite from the tropical heat.

Tips for Visiting Mag-Aso Falls
To make the most of your visit to Mag-Aso Falls, keep these tips in mind:
- Wear Comfortable Footwear: The trail to the falls can be slippery, especially after rain. Wear sturdy, non-slip shoes to ensure a safe trek.
- Bring Swimwear: Don’t forget to pack your swimwear if you plan to dip in the cool waters. A change of clothes is also recommended.
- Pack Snacks and Drinks: There are limited facilities near the falls, so it’s a good idea to bring your snacks and drinks to enjoy during your visit.
- Respect Nature: Keep the area clean by disposing of your trash properly. Respect the natural environment and avoid disturbing the wildlife.
How to Get There
Reaching Mag-Aso Falls is an adventure in itself. From Bacolod City, you can take a bus or van bound for Kabankalan City, approximately 90 kilometers away. The journey takes around two hours. Once in Kabankalan, you can hire a tricycle or motorcycle to take you to the falls. The scenic drive through the countryside offers glimpses of local life and picturesque landscapes, adding to the overall experience.

Manjuyod Sandbar
Often referred to as the “Maldives of the Philippines,” Manjuyod Sandbar is a pristine white-sand bar off Bais City’s coast. The sandbar emerges during low tide, creating a stunning stretch of beach surrounded by crystal-clear waters. Visitors can enjoy swimming, snorkeling, and even dolphin watching in the nearby Tañon Strait. The journey to Manjuyod Sandbar involves a boat ride, adding to the adventure and allure of this natural wonder.
